Ticket: Enable log sampling on Quillbox notifier service

The Quillbox notifier emits roughly 40k log lines per minute, most of them duplicate retry notices. This floods the support dashboard and makes incident triage slow. Proposal: apply 1-in-50 sampling to INFO-level retry logs while keeping all WARN and ERROR lines untouched. Support workflows that grep for delivery confirmations are unaffected, since those log at WARN. Rollout is behind a config flag and reversible within minutes. Sign-off is required from the individual named below.

approver of kajog-yahig = Zoreth Norys Zorael Oliir

The Addrly address autocomplete widget stopped returning suggestions in the staging environment on Monday. Investigation shows the internal credential used by the widget's lookup service expired over the weekend, so every request to the suggestion backend now returns an auth error. As the contractor picking this up, please update the staging configuration under `services/addrly/env` and redeploy; no code changes are needed. A fresh replacement key has been issued and appears directly below.

app token of bawep-hafog = kto7_vwrmnlx

Handover for the weekly eng sync: I'm transferring ownership of Duskrunner, our nightly backfill scheduler, to Priya. Current state: all jobs healthy except the ledger-reconciliation backfill, which retries once nightly due to a slow upstream from the Kestwick warehouse. Retry logic, window sizing, and concurrency caps were all tuned carefully last quarter — please don't change them without a load test. For full transparency at the sync, the production instance runs with these configuration values.

settings of hawep-kadug:
RALAEL_HOST=ralael.tolvaqlabs.internal
RALAEL_PORT=9000

Handover note — Crumbwheel order cutoffs.

Welcome aboard. The bakery cutoff rule in Crumbwheel closes same-day orders at 14:00 local to each storefront, not UTC — this has bitten us twice. Holiday overrides live in the calendar service and take precedence silently, so always check there first when a cutoff looks wrong. To unlock the calendar service's admin console after a restart, enter the recovery passphrase below.

vault phrase of bagap-bahaf = silion-pelox-sorox-casdor-quenwyn-fraax-eliox-praael-kelion-quenvan-kasox-rusael-norius-belvan